INSTALLATION

The stainless steel exterior of the cabinet has been protected by a plastic covering during manufacturing and shipping. This covering
can be readily stripped before installation. After removing this covering, wash the interior and exterior surfaces using a warm, mild
soapy water solution and a sponge or cloth, rinse with clean water and dry.
Casters
Models without a base come with Casters. To install them, tilt the unit and thread the Casters into the four Rivnuts in the bottom of
the cabinet. Make sure that they are installed tightly to prevent future thread wear. Return the unit to the upright position. **Allow
at least two hours of off time before connecting to a power source.
Condenser Air Curtain
The Air Curtain is packaged inside the unit. The instructions for installing this part are included in this technical manual. Do not
operate the unit without the air curtain installed!
Pans and Pan Supports
The Pans and Pan Supports are packaged with the unit. Instructions for locating the Pan Supports are included in this technical
manual.
Cutting Board
The Cutting Board Brackets and mounting instructions are shipped with the cabinet. After the Cutting Board Brackets are in place,
the Cutting Board will nest inside them.
Shelves
Inside the unit you will find Shelves and a plastic bag containing Shelf Supports. The Shelf Supports with the "tang" go on the rear
Pilasters. This shelf system allows for easy adjustment to suit your needs.
Door Adjustment
Should the Door ever require straightening, loosen the Screws on the Hinges, square the Door with the cabinet and retighten the
Screws.
Location
When locating your new refrigerator, convenience and accessibility are important considerations, but the following installation
guidelines must be followed;
• Always avoid placing the refrigerator adjacent to an oven, heating element or hot air source that would affect the operation of the
unit.
• For proper ventilation the bottom front of the unit must not be obstructed. The unit must be on legs or casters to raise it off the
floor. The unit can be installed tight on the sides and back.
• The unit must be level or tilted backwards slightly.
Electrical Connections
Be sure to check the data plate, located on the liner of the cabinet, for required voltage prior to connecting the unit to power. The
specifications on the data plate supersede any future discussion.
Your Silver King refrigerator is equipped with an eight (8) foot power cord. Any attempt to modify the plug will void the warranty,
terminate the manufacturers responsibility, and could result in serious injury.
If the supply cord is damaged, it must be replaced by the manufacturer, its service agent or similarly qualified persons in order to
avoid a hazard.
The circuit must be protected with a 15 or 20 ampere fuse or breaker. The unit must be isolated on a circuit and not plugged into an
extension cord.
Climate Class Rating
Your Silver King Prep Table has a climate class 4 rating. It is designed for use in areas not exceeding 30°C (86°F).
